Thus, the Smallest Two-Digit Number Is: A Fundamental Building Block of Mathematics
Thus, the Smallest Two-Digit Number Is: A Fundamental Building Block of Mathematics
When exploring the fascinating world of numbers, one common question arises: What is the smallest two-digit number? Understanding this simple yet essential fact opens the door to deeper insights into number theory, place value, and mathematical fundamentals.
Thus, the smallest two-digit number is 10.
Understanding the Context
This number marks the beginning of the two-digit range, defined universally by having a value between 10 and 99. At 10, the digit structure shifts from single-digit (1–9) to a meaningful combination of digits: the “1” in the tens place and the “0” in the ones place. This shift represents more than just a numerical jump—it embodies the concept of place value, a cornerstone of our decimal system.
Why 10 Is Uniquely the Smallest Two-Digit Number
-
Place Value Significance: In base-10 numeration, the first digit (leftmost in a two-digit number) represents tens. The smallest non-zero digit in this position is “1,” giving the meaningful value 10. -
Mathematical Continuity: Numbers increment sequentially. Between 9 and 10, there are no valid two-digit integers. Therefore, 10 is the immediate successor and the smallest valid two-digit number.
